Web aside from his writing and political involvement, he was an inspired draughts¬man, producing about 3,000 drawings. Web when not writing les misérables and photographing his life in exile on the british channel islands between 1852 and 1870, victor hugo drew for private pleasure.

Originally pursued as a casual hobby, drawing became more important to hugo shortly before his exile when he made the decision to stop writing to devote himself to politics.
